X-Git-Url: http://de.git.xonotic.org/?a=blobdiff_plain;f=mvm_cmds.c;h=e34428317c8e1e17f16568917403dd355465a869;hb=406899eb226c2aaf9ff20abdccb6e6823b02b376;hp=337d196bd037d5794d44f06b4c785841b78de60a;hpb=f603e392a4dc9b7da2732bc3c14585d54de99b7e;p=xonotic%2Fdarkplaces.git diff --git a/mvm_cmds.c b/mvm_cmds.c index 337d196b..e3442831 100644 --- a/mvm_cmds.c +++ b/mvm_cmds.c @@ -193,19 +193,10 @@ static void VM_M_getresolution(prvm_prog_t *prog) } else if(nr == -1) { - vid_mode_t *m = VID_GetDesktopMode(); - if (m) - { - PRVM_G_VECTOR(OFS_RETURN)[0] = m->width; - PRVM_G_VECTOR(OFS_RETURN)[1] = m->height; - PRVM_G_VECTOR(OFS_RETURN)[2] = m->pixelheight_num / (prvm_vec_t) m->pixelheight_denom; - } - else - { - PRVM_G_VECTOR(OFS_RETURN)[0] = 0; - PRVM_G_VECTOR(OFS_RETURN)[1] = 0; - PRVM_G_VECTOR(OFS_RETURN)[2] = 0; - } + vid_mode_t m = VID_GetDesktopMode(); + PRVM_G_VECTOR(OFS_RETURN)[0] = m.width; + PRVM_G_VECTOR(OFS_RETURN)[1] = m.height; + PRVM_G_VECTOR(OFS_RETURN)[2] = m.pixelheight_num / (prvm_vec_t) m.pixelheight_denom; } else { @@ -1058,8 +1049,7 @@ void VM_cin_restart(prvm_prog_t *prog) static void VM_M_registercommand(prvm_prog_t *prog) { VM_SAFEPARMCOUNT(1, VM_M_registercommand); - if(!Cmd_Exists(cmd_client, PRVM_G_STRING(OFS_PARM0))) - Cmd_AddCommand(CF_CLIENT, PRVM_G_STRING(OFS_PARM0), NULL, "console command created by QuakeC"); + Cmd_AddCommand(CF_CLIENT, PRVM_G_STRING(OFS_PARM0), NULL, "console command created by QuakeC"); } prvm_builtin_t vm_m_builtins[] = { @@ -1076,7 +1066,7 @@ VM_vlen, // #9 VM_vectoyaw, // #10 VM_vectoangles, // #11 VM_random, // #12 -VM_localcmd_client, // #13 +VM_localcmd_local, // #13 VM_cvar, // #14 VM_cvar_set, // #15 VM_dprint, // #16